💡
原文英文,约6700词,阅读约需25分钟。
📝
内容提要
上周Postgres Extension生态系统迷你峰会上,Devrim Gündüz作为Postgres社区存储库维护者进行了全面的演讲,介绍了存储库内容、扩展打包和更新、依赖外部存储库的问题等。他还讨论了与扩展维护者合作、与上游协调等问题,以及构建和维护RPM的挑战,与发行版的兼容性问题,以及构建服务器的成本和维护构建系统的复杂性。
🎯
关键要点
- 上周Postgres扩展生态系统迷你峰会,Devrim Gündüz进行了全面演讲,讨论了存储库内容、扩展打包和更新等问题。
- 演讲中提到与扩展维护者合作、与上游协调的挑战,以及构建和维护RPM的复杂性。
- Devrim Gündüz介绍了Postgres Yum和ZYpp存储库的历史和发展,强调了社区控制的重要性。
- 他讨论了扩展的打包过程,包括如何处理不同Postgres版本的扩展和依赖关系。
- 演讲中提到的内容包括常见和非常见RPM的分类,以及如何处理非自由软件的依赖问题。
- Devrim还提到维护构建系统的成本和复杂性,尤其是在RedHat和SUSE等发行版的兼容性问题上。
- 他强调了扩展维护者的责任,呼吁开发者及时更新和维护他们的扩展。
- 演讲中提到的一个主要问题是缺乏对扩展更新的通知,导致维护者无法及时响应。
- Devrim Gündüz还讨论了如何处理扩展之间的依赖关系,以及如何在不同的Linux发行版上构建和维护这些扩展。
- 最后,他提到维护构建服务器的成本和复杂性,强调了持续更新和测试的重要性。
❓
延伸问答
Devrim Gündüz在迷你峰会上讨论了哪些主要内容?
他讨论了存储库内容、扩展打包和更新、与扩展维护者合作的挑战等问题。
扩展的打包过程是怎样的?
扩展的打包过程包括处理不同Postgres版本的扩展和依赖关系,并使用PGXS进行管理。
维护构建系统的挑战有哪些?
维护构建系统的挑战包括成本、复杂性以及与不同Linux发行版的兼容性问题。
Devrim Gündüz提到的扩展维护者的责任是什么?
他强调扩展维护者应及时更新和维护他们的扩展,以确保兼容性和安全性。
在扩展更新中存在哪些主要问题?
一个主要问题是缺乏对扩展更新的通知,导致维护者无法及时响应。
Postgres Yum和ZYpp存储库的历史是什么?
Postgres Yum和ZYpp存储库自2007年开始成为社区的官方RPM存储库,强调了社区控制的重要性。
🏷️
标签
➡️